There are a few alcohol and drug rehab programs that help individuals through their issues with drug and alcohol addiction without making them pay for their services. For example, there are government-funded drug and alcohol treatment facilities that are funded publicly or even paid for via either federal/state funds. A few of these facilities operate out of mental health centers funded by the state or paid for via local governments, and alcohol and drug treatment centers and clinics. Many of these facilities have certain conditions that individuals in Macksville need to meet to get treatment, and people of low income and with limited or no insurance are usually the most typical people at rehabs where there is no fee. To receive care at a rehab where no payment is accepted, you may need to prove your residency in the state and possibly your legal residency in the U.S., provide information regarding income or lack thereof, and be available for an assessment of your drug history, physical health and mental health.
If a person if seeking an alcohol and drug rehab center where no payment is accepted, a great place to start looking is with their state or local substance abuse and mental health agencies. Another source of assistance is local church organizations and similar faith-based organizations who run programs which include services for alcohol and drug dependency and addiction. A number of these groups even provide beds for individuals while they are in treatment and until they get back on their feet.
